Climate overview of Avoca
Avoca, Iowa, United States of America, experiences significant temperature variation throughout the year. Summers bring daytime highs of 29°C (84°F) in July, while winters cool to -1°C (30°F) in January.
Avoca sees a moderate amount of rain/snowfall, totalling around 923 mm (36 in) per year. It experiences a distinct dry season from January to March, creating some seasonal variation. The sunniest month is July, with 11.2 hours of sunshine per day on average.

Monthly Temperature in Avoca
Depending on the time of the year, temperatures range from comfortable to very cold in Avoca. Average maximum daytime temperatures range from a comfortable 29°C (84°F) in July, the warmest time of the year, to a very cold -1°C (30°F) during cooler months like January.
At night, you can expect temperatures ranging from 18°C (64°F) in July to around -12°C (10°F) during January.

Rainfall in Avoca
Generally, Avoca has a moderate amount of precipitation, averaging 923 mm (36 in) of rain/snowfall annually. Significant seasonal changes in precipitation occur throughout the year. In the wettest month, June it receives high rainfall, averaging 153 mm (6 in) of precipitation, recorded across 13 rainy days. In contrast, the driest month January brings less snowfall, with 15 mm (0.6 in) over 5 snowy days. For more details, please visit our Avoca Precipitation page.

Sunshine Hours in Avoca
Seasonal changes in sunshine hours are quite dramatic in Avoca. While July receives considerable daily sunshine with up to 11.2 hours, December marks the darkest time of the year, where sunshine is scarce with only 4.4 hours of sunlight per day.

Humidity in Avoca by Month
The relative humidity is high throughout the year in Avoca.
The city experiences its highest humidity in January, reaching 71%. In April, the humidity drops to its lowest level at 60%. What does this mean? Read our detailed page on humidity levels for further details.

Frequently asked questions about the climate in Avoca
What is the best time to visit Avoca?
July and September typically offer the most optimal weather in Avoca. In contrast, January, February, March and December tend to have less optimal conditions. Avoca has a distinct dry season from January to March.
What temperatures can I expect in Avoca?
Daytime highs range from -1°C (30°F) in January to 29°C (84°F) in July. Nighttime lows range from -12°C (10°F) to 18°C (64°F). Temperatures vary considerably through the year.
How much rain does Avoca get?
Annual rainfall is around 923 mm (36 in). June is the wettest month with 153 mm (6 in), while January is the driest with 15 mm (0.6 in).
How sunny is Avoca?
Avoca receives around 2,736 hours of sunshine per year. July is the sunniest month with 335 hours, while December is the cloudiest with just 133 hours. Overall, Avoca enjoys abundant sunshine.
